Homeshare: A New Trend in Shared Living

Introduction:

Shared living arrangements have become increasingly popular in recent years, with people looking for affordable and flexible housing options. Homeshare is a unique concept in shared living that brings together individuals with different needs and circumstances, providing a mutually beneficial arrangement. This article explores the idea of homeshare, its benefits, and how it is transforming the way people live.

Benefits of Homeshare:

1. Affordable Housing:

One of the primary reasons why people choose homeshare is the cost-effectiveness it offers. Rent and property prices are soaring in many cities, making it difficult for individuals on a tight budget to find suitable accommodations. Homeshare provides an opportunity to share expenses, allowing residents to live in desirable areas without breaking the bank. This affordable housing option is particularly attractive for students, young professionals, and retirees on fixed incomes.

2. Companionship and Community:

Homeshare not only provides a roof over one's head but also fosters companionship and community. For individuals who live alone or are new to a city, the prospect of sharing a home with someone can be a welcoming experience. Homeshare arrangements often match residents based on compatible personalities and shared interests, creating an environment where residents can form meaningful relationships and support one another.

3. Assistance and Support:

Homeshare is particularly beneficial for individuals who require assistance with daily tasks. Elderly or disabled individuals, for instance, can find companions who can help with household chores, grocery shopping, or even providing company during medical appointments. Homeshare arrangements are often designed to meet the specific needs of each resident, ensuring that everyone's requirements are taken into consideration and addressed accordingly.

Transforming the Way People Live:

1. Breaking the Mold of Traditional Housing:

Homeshare challenges the traditional concept of housing, where every individual or family lives in a separate dwelling. It introduces the idea of sharing resources, reducing waste, and minimizing the ecological footprint. By utilizing existing housing stock more efficiently, homeshare contributes to a more sustainable and environmentally friendly way of living.

2. Promoting Social Inclusion and Integration:

Homeshare arrangements often cross generational, cultural, and social boundaries, promoting social inclusion and integration. The diversity within the homeshare community creates an environment of tolerance, understanding, and acceptance. Residents gain exposure to different perspectives, cultures, and backgrounds, enhancing their own personal growth and expanding their horizons.

3. Enabling Aging in Place:

As the global population ages, the need for suitable housing options for seniors becomes increasingly important. Homeshare offers a viable solution, allowing elderly individuals to age in place while receiving the necessary support and assistance. The companionship and help provided by a homeshare partner can greatly enhance the quality of life for seniors, reducing social isolation and ensuring their well-being.
